Output 38bb376c5ebe7815c9fc11db49a2400a459a040ae9845238af0b687b42bee3ff:1

value
29066
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0f663675cdc755df5d593e8b36007bbfcdf32525 OP_EQUALVERIFY OP_CHECKSIG
address
12QRak5kUZN1NoMP9qDNCDQizqKQp3oska
transaction
38bb376c5ebe7815c9fc11db49a2400a459a040ae9845238af0b687b42bee3ff
confirmations
514291
spent
true